Jags cagers shock Cardinal Newman; land spot in NBL playoffs
The Jaguars saved their best basketball for the final stretch of the North Bay League season, upending heavily favored Cardinal Newman, 57-55 on an emotionally charged Senior Night on Feb. 5.

Eagles softball and baseball teams maintain second place
Cloverdale High School baseball and softball teams are within shouting distance of first place at the halfway point of league play, hoping to make a strong push as they enter the final phase of the regular season.
Catholic Youth Organization basketball game of the week
A heartbreaking 25-23 loss to St. Eugene’s of Santa Rosa is this week’s Our Lady of Guadalupe Church’s Catholic Youth Organization game of the week. The fourth grade boys did have their largest scoring outburst of the season but dropped to 0-7 in North Bay CYO play.
